Product details

The 201-ball UFBGA (10x10 mm) package keeps the footprint compact but demands careful PCB fan-out and decoupling — not a hand-solderable part.

No last-time-buy notice, no end-of-life clock ticking. For the procurement desk, that means standard lead times through distribution and no urgency to stockpile. The base product number is STM32F767, so PCNs and errata roll up under that family umbrella.

Memory and I/O — sizing the BOM

1 MB of Flash gives you room for a full Ethernet stack, a graphics library, or dual firmware banks for OTA updates. The 512 KB SRAM handles display frame buffers or large data arrays without external memory. 140 I/O pins in a 201-ball BGA mean most of those balls are GPIO — good for parallel buses, camera interfaces, or a lot of sensors. The 12-bit ADC has 24 channels; the DAC has 2 channels.

Suitable for outdoor telecom, factory automation, motor drives, and engine-bay-adjacent electronics that see temperature swings but not the full automotive under-hood range.

Frequently asked questions

What is the closest pin-compatible alternative to STM32F767IGK6?

The STM32F767 family includes multiple density and package variants. A pin-compatible alternative within the same 201-UFBGA footprint would be a higher-density sibling like the STM32F769IGK6 (with additional graphics features) or a lower-density STM32F765IGK6. Verify exact memory and peripheral differences against your firmware requirements.

What is STM32F767IGK6's listed speed?

The core runs at 216 MHz. That is the maximum clock for the ARM Cortex-M7 on this device, with flash wait states configured accordingly.
